| v. t. | 1. | To harm or destroy the good fame or reputation of; to disgrace; especially, to speak evil of maliciously; to dishonor by slanderous reports; to calumniate; to asperse. |
| 2. | To render infamous; to bring into disrepute. | |
| 3. | To charge; to accuse. | |
| n. | 1. | Dishonor. |
| Verb | 1. | defame - charge falsely or with malicious intent; attack the good name and reputation of someone; "The journalists have defamed me!" "The article in the paper sullied my reputation" |
